  • Transcription

    Sunday May 17, 1931. Called on Mrs. Barker, 1 Hamilton Gardens, Felixstowe (granddaughter of Lady Palgrave) She has -
    (1) A very early w.c (c.1801) of an old wall, gateway &
    tower, with cottage. J.S.Cotman. 8" x 8".
    (2) The Boleyn Tomb, Blickling. c.1806-7. 12" x 17"
    (3)*** Three Hills on the Norfolk Dunes, near Yarmouth.
    c. 1818 - 1822. 8" x 13".
    (4) The Astrologer based on the etchings of seated man, but without
    figure of woman coming round screen, on r.
    green & scarlet. C.1828 - 30. 9 x 7 1/2.
    (5)** A Normandy Church, Sepia, (?) Briville.
    with inset of pencil sketch of 'effect' & note by
    M.A. Turner about Cotman's preliminary sketches.
    11 x 16.
    (6)** Distant view of a village in Normandy, with
    landscape panorama, cows in foreground.
    11 3/4 x 18. Sepia.
    (7) On the Caledonian Canal. Sepia. (?) if by C.
    c 11 x 17.
    ------------"------------
    A large watercolour, Bp. Goldswell's Tomb, Norwich Cathedral, a very fine drawing, attributed to Cotman, but too mechanical: I shd. attribute it to Thirtle c. 1807-8.
